The 40th annual Comic-Con International is arriving soon, and Microsoft plans on bringing out all the big guns such as Gears of War 3, Kinect, Halo: Rech, Fable III, and more.
Gears of War fans will be treated to a panel with Cliff Bleszinski, Rod Fergusson, and author Karen Traviss on Friday, with all three showing up for a developer signing on Saturday at Microsoft’s booth.

This ranks 150 percent on the revelationometer: Epic’s planning DLC for Gears of War 3.
But speaking to EGTV, Epic design chief Cliff Bleszinski wouldn’t go into any specifics.
“Well, we do have plans for DLC,” said Bleszinski, “but we’re not really talking about it. We’re still trying to figure out what it is.”
He said he’d like to “do something completely crazy” with add-on content, and is apparently “a fan of DLC that takes risks.”
He said: “I think the DLC that’s been the biggest success in the past have been the ones that have been consistent, like every so many months, like Borderlands or Fallout.
“And they also play with the formula a little bit, you know – like Fallout adding in giant robots and UFOs, that doesn’t feel like it was on the cutting-room floor.”

Gears of War 3 will land on planet earth come April 2011 exclusively for the Xbox 360, and according to Epic Games Cliff Bleszinski, it’ll be the “best looking” Gears title to date.
Speaking on the Eurogamer TV Show, Bleszinski said they were hoping to make the third installment better, in every way than the prior titles.
“I like to say that Gears 3 is going to be the best looking, most fun and most feature rich and more importantly the most polished Gears game we’ve ever produced. It’s the beauty of shipping in April 2011 – it buy us that extra time to spit-shine it a little bit.”
